Kehlani Claims her R&B Crown
Oakland-native Kehlani has single-handedly clinched a song of the year spot for 2025 when she released her song that is "Folded" mid-year. This single alone has broke so many records and milestones for the artist, landing her a first-time solo Billboard Hot 100 Top 10 hit (No. 7), No. 1 and longest-running song on the Hot R&B/Hip-Hop Songs chart, and most importantly, has been played 6,285 times through my AirPods over the course of 4 months (which, in my mind, is like winning a Grammy).

What people aren't aware of, though, is that she has been 'that girl' for over a decade. Chances are, you've heard a song or two. If you haven't, give the songs "After Hours" or "Distraction" a listen. Might I add that she is featured on a plethora of elite discographies, including (but not limited to) Cardi B, Charlie Puth, Jhené Aiko, and Justin Bieber.

On a serious note, this is not the first time Thomas has basked in the spotlight. Taking after his role in Victorious , he is an award-winning writer and producer.

Thomas worked on various notable projects, including:
- Writing and producing for GIVĒON, Kehlani, and Toni Braxton
- Co-wrote "Snooze" by SZA, which won a Grammy for Best R&B Song
- Co-produced on Drake's Certified Lover Boy
- Co-produced on Ariana Grande's Yours Truly and produced some songs on Positions.

Newly-engaged Mariah the Scientist has had a whirlwhind of a year with her hit song "Burning Blue" creating a distinctive sound for herself , which she would use in her new album HEARTS SOLD SEPERATELY. I must say, "Is It A Crime" is such a beautiful song (and Kali Uchis couldn't have been a better feature!!)

Fun fact: Miss Mariah actually studied biology on a scholarship at St. Johns University, hence her creative stage name.
